AvaTrade overview

Regulated by six bodies: FCA, ASIC, CySEC, FSCA, FSA Japan, ADGM. Segregated client accounts. Operating since 2006.

Platforms include MT4, MT5, a mobile app called AvaTradeGO, and browser-based WebTrader. Use whichever you like. Same account works across all of them.

Spreads on EUR/USD begin at 0.9 pips. No commission on top.

Be aware of the inactivity charge. $50 per quarter if you don't trade for three months.

Good fit for

Beginners wanting solid regulation and platform choice. Traders interested in AvaProtect trade insurance.

Not ideal for

High-frequency traders. The spreads are fine but not exceptional. Heavy volume traders get better rates at ECN brokers.

Those looking to buy actual equities. AvaTrade is CFDs only.

US residents. Not available in the United States.
